WebApr 6, 2024 · Previously, the LSAT was administered at borrowed sites like classrooms or auditoriums. Test-takers had strict rules about what they could bring on test day, and they … WebLaw School Admission Test (LSAT) is a 2.5 hour standardized test that applicants may take in order to apply to law school. The other option is the GRE. Unlike the GRE, the LSAT is accepted by all law schools in the US to fulfill their standardized testing requirement. The vast majority of applicants choose to take the LSAT over the GRE. WebJun 13, 2024 · Schools in the US often accept scores from tests as late as July and application deadlines extend into the summer. But that is not the case in Canada. The majority of the 24 law schools in Canada list January as the latest LSAT they will accept. WebOct 2, 2024 · LSAT scores can range from a low of 120 to a perfect score of 180. The average LSAT score is between 150 and 151, but most students accepted to top law schools receive a score well over 160. WebSep 29, 2024 · The on-time registration fee for the 2024 LAT is $189 (GST inclusive). The registration fee covers online registration, materials required for the test and provision of test results. Late registration incurs an additional $50 fee. UNSW Law & Justice has waived the remote proctoring levy for all candidates in 2024.
